Just pulled up the actual BTC/USDT 4h chart on Gate to get real numbers instead of guessing. Current price is 75,657, and if you scroll back on this chart you can see the whole story, BTC ground sideways near 63,400 for a while, then broke out hard, ran all the way up toward the 82,878 area, and has spent the last several sessions fading back down into the mid 75k zone. That's roughly a 9 percent pullback from the recent high, still sitting well above where the move even started.
Here's what I keep telling myself looking at moves like this. A sharp breakout followed by a slow bleed isn't automatically bearish, it's often just the market digesting the people who bought the top. What matters more is whether price holds above the old breakout zone, which for this move looks like it's somewhere in the low 70s. As long as that structure holds, I treat this as consolidation, not reversal. I learned that lesson the expensive way years ago, panic selling a pullback that was really just a pause.
